Renton to Yakima

Updated: 28 May 2026

The distance from Renton to Yakima is approximately 200 kilometers. Driving via I-90 and I-82 is the most efficient method, taking about two and a half hours. This is a scenic drive through the Cascade Mountains. Most travelers prefer driving as it is the most convenient and practical way to reach Yakima from Renton.

Total Distance: 200 km driving distance, 160 km straight-line air distance.
